
然而,即便是这样一款成熟的数据库系统,用户在使用过程中也难免会遇到各种问题,其中最常见且令人头痛的莫过于登录时显示的错误
本文旨在深入探讨MySQL登录显示错误的成因,并提供相应的解决方案,以帮助用户更高效地应对此类问题
一、MySQL登录错误的常见类型 在解析MySQL登录错误之前,我们首先需要了解这些错误的常见类型
根据错误信息的不同,MySQL登录错误大致可以分为以下几类: 1.访问拒绝错误:这类错误通常表现为“Access denied for user”的提示,意味着用户试图以非法的用户名或密码登录MySQL服务器
2.连接错误:当用户尝试连接到MySQL服务器时,可能会遇到“Cant connect to MySQL server”或“Connection refused”等错误提示,这通常是由于网络问题或MySQL服务未正常运行所致
3.配置错误:如果MySQL的配置文件(如my.cnf或my.ini)设置不当,也可能导致登录错误
例如,错误的绑定地址或端口设置都可能阻止用户正常登录
4.权限问题:有时用户可能因为没有足够的权限而无法登录到特定的数据库
这种情况下,错误提示可能会包含有关权限不足的信息
二、登录错误的成因分析 了解了常见的错误类型后,我们进一步探究这些错误背后的成因
1.访问拒绝错误的成因: - 用户输入了错误的用户名或密码
- 用户试图从未经授权的主机登录
-用户的账户已被锁定或删除
- 密码加密方式不兼容,尤其是在MySQL版本升级后
2.连接错误的成因: - MySQL服务未启动或已停止
-防火墙设置阻止了MySQL的端口
- MySQL的bind-address配置不正确,导致服务器无法监听正确的IP地址
- 网络问题,如DNS解析失败、网络超时等
3.配置错误的成因: -配置文件中的语法错误
-配置文件中的参数设置不合理,如内存分配过多导致服务无法启动
-配置文件中的路径设置错误,指向了不存在的文件或目录
4.权限问题的成因: - 用户没有被授予足够的权限来访问特定的数据库或表
-用户的权限被撤销或更改
- 数据库或表的权限设置发生了变更,导致用户无法访问
三、解决MySQL登录错误的方法 针对上述不同类型的登录错误及其成因,我们可以采取以下措施进行解决: 1.解决访问拒绝错误: - 确认输入的用户名和密码是否正确
- 检查用户是否有权从当前主机登录
- 联系数据库管理员确认账户状态
- 如果是密码加密方式不兼容,考虑重置密码或升级客户端库
2.解决连接错误: - 检查MySQL服务是否正在运行,并尝试重新启动服务
- 检查防火墙设置,确保MySQL的端口没有被阻止
-验证bind-address配置是否正确,确保服务器能够监听正确的IP地址
-排查网络问题,如检查DNS设置、网络连接状态等
3.解决配置错误: -仔细检查配置文件中的语法和参数设置,确保没有错误或不合理之处
-参考MySQL官方文档或社区资源,了解配置参数的合理取值范围
- 确保配置文件中的路径设置正确,指向的文件或目录确实存在
4.解决权限问题: - 联系数据库管理员,请求授予足够的权限
- 检查并确认用户的权限设置,确保没有被撤销或更改
- 如果是数据库或表的权限设置变更导致的问题,尝试调整权限设置以恢复访问
四、总结 MySQL登录显示错误虽然令人头痛,但并非无法解决
通过深入了解错误的类型和成因,我们可以有针对性地采取措施进行排查和解决
在实际操作中,建议用户保持冷静,逐步排查可能的原因,并参考官方文档和社区资源寻求帮助
同时,定期备份数据库和配置文件也是防止意外情况发生的重要措施
希望本文能够帮助读者更好地应对MySQL登录显示错误,提升数据库使用的效率和安全性
MySQL逻辑分页技巧,高效处理大数据这个标题简洁明了,既包含了关键词“MySQL逻辑分页
MySQL登录遇阻?快速解决错误提示!这个标题既体现了问题的关键词“MySQL登录”和“错
MySQL索引背后的秘密:为何B树成为最佳选择?
MySQL导数缓慢?提速秘籍大揭秘!
轻松调整MySQL字段顺序,数据库管理新技巧
MySQL事务排队机制:高效决策,助力企业美好明天
MySQL数值转百分数技巧解析
MySQL逻辑分页技巧,高效处理大数据这个标题简洁明了,既包含了关键词“MySQL逻辑分页
MySQL索引背后的秘密:为何B树成为最佳选择?
MySQL导数缓慢?提速秘籍大揭秘!
轻松调整MySQL字段顺序,数据库管理新技巧
MySQL事务排队机制:高效决策,助力企业美好明天
MySQL数值转百分数技巧解析
MySQL外键约束索引添加技巧大揭秘或者快速掌握:MySQL外键与索引添加方法(注:以上标
Apex集成MySQL实战指南
解决MySQL脚本执行报错1064,轻松排查SQL语法错误
精选MySQL源码版本,哪个更适合你?
MySQL毫秒级数据处理:高效决策,快人一步
MySQL左连接无数据解决方案